How you’ll make an impact in this role
- Lead the Nursing Shift Coordinator team to deliver safe, high-quality patient care while meeting daily clinical and operational objectives.
- Coordinate nursing assignments based on patient acuity, staffing needs, physician priorities, and population-specific care requirements.
- Monitor nursing staff performance, provide education, and promote clinical quality, patient safety, compliance, and productivity standards.
- Collaborate with the interdisciplinary team to resolve patient care concerns, coordinate resources, and support effective care delivery.
What minimum requirements you’ll need
Licensure / Certification / Registration:
- BLS Provider obtained within 1 Month (30 days) of hire date or job transfer date required. American Heart Association or American Red Cross Accepted.
- Registered Nurse obtained prior to hire date or job transfer date required.
- One or more of the following required:
- Advanced Life Support obtained within 6 Months (180 days) of hire date or job transfer date. American Heart Association or American Red Cross Accepted. Required if working in adult critical care setting.
- Certification specializing in The S.T.A.B.L.E Program obtained within 6 Months (180 days) of hire date or job transfer date. Required if working in labor & delivery setting.
- Certification specializing in Neonatal Resuscitation credentialed from the American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) obtained prior to hire date or job transfer date. Required if working in labor & delivery setting.
- Pediatric Advanced Life Support obtained within 6 Months (180 days) of hire date or job transfer date. American Heart Association or American Red Cross Accepted. Required if working in pediatric critical care setting.
Education:
- Required professional licensure/certification AND 1 year of cumulative job specific experience required.
